The founder and proprietor of the Advanced Body Sculpt Centre, Dr. Dominic Kwame Obeng-Andoh, has descended on the Ghana Medical Council after an Accra Circuit Court ruled on his case.

YEN.com.gh understands that the court found him not guilty mainly due to the manner in which the charges against him were presented in court.

The court again ruled that there were inconsistencies in the submission of the prosecution witnesses.

Dr. Obeng-Andoh was charged with working as an unregistered medical practitioner and also operating an unlicensed health facility.

Following the ruling of the court, the registrar of the Ghana Medical and Dental Council, Dr. Eli K, Atikpui, explained that the council would request for the details of the ruling and make its position clear on it.

He added that Dr. Obeng-Andoh “is not in good standing with the Medical and Dental Council”.

This did not go down well with Dr. Obeng-Andoh who said the deception of the council is sickening.

Per a report by 3news.com, he added that he is a paid-up member of the council and consequently provided evidence of the renewal of his license.
